OOOOCOQOOOOOOOOQO OOOOOOOOOOOOO 33 35 41 43 45 47 49 51 53 INTMA15 3 5 11 13 15 17 19 21 23 25 CO QO OOOOO O O Q O O QO O O QO Mach2000 User Manual page 36 41 Stila Energy Mach2000 User Manual page 37 41 Stila Energy Appendix B Logical bypass option TECHNICAL DESCRIPTION Rel 01 2006 STILA ENERGY S p A Via Ippodromo 61 20151 MILANO ITALY Phone 39 02 40 91 83 10 Fax 39 02 40 91 70 52 e mail top stilaenergy com Mach2000 User Manual page 38 41 Stila Energy B Logical bypass option This option allows the Mach2000 to shift from any working modes excluded the stabilized voltage one to the stabilized voltage mode The shift occurs simply with the closing of a O Volt clean contact normally open When this contact reopens the Mach2000 will go back into it s initial operating mode Such an option is useful when in some situations like an emergency one you may want to move from a low voltage situation with reduced luminosity to a temporary one with an output voltage close to the nominal one and therefore maximum light output This command can be generated automatically or manually by the user For instance it could come from starting up of a UPS or a generator anti theft system manual override BUS system int

I uz HOS LNI SIVONVYS 068 9SPETZL LO ZL SZ JLva 9 L 8Vv1S 022 AdNM LO LdAM ALIWNOLAY TYANYN HSI19N3 ONVITV1I CxyOMSSVd MAN f 70 cL AWIL G0 LOV3 c0 LdNd OLZ AdNS LO LdNS CYOMSSVd Mach2000 User Manual Stila Energy 14 ALARMS The system shows on the display and with the help of two red and yellow LEDs on the front panel some alarm conditions which can in some cases disable and or automatically by pass if present the Mach2000 14 1 TEMPERATURE ALARM This alarm is generated following a condition of prolonged overloading when one or more temperature sensors located inside each transformer one per phase detect a temperature higher than the preset value 120 C After the abnormal condition is detected the electronic controller activates the automatic power by pass if present or it simply shuts down the appliance to protect it from any damages The alarm condition is indicated by a message on the display and by the flashing of the red LED on the front panel Once the cause of the overload has been eliminated you can restart the Mach2000 by resetting the thermal breaker located inside the device by turning the door locking switch to OFF If the load conditions in amps per phase were returned within the rated values of the appliance and the temperature alarm is nevertheless generated the following controls are necessary i check if the technical room where th

7. frequency of the maintenance jobs varies according to machine model and installation place Temperature dust and vibrations have negative influence making more frequent overhauls necessary The recommended intervals are from 6 to 12 months short intervals for very powerful machines and or for dusty high temperature places long intervals for low power machines installed in places with good climatic conditions Operations to be carried out external inspection of the appliance check the efficiency of handles if present and or locks if present and of the door locking selector switch check correct operation of doors if present check condition of the electronic control unit and check the relevant connectors eliminate dust or particles accumulated inside clean and if necessary replace the filters of the ventilation fans check the operation of the ventilation fan check and tighten all internal terminals check general operation and the efficiency of the set time and date controls check the condition of the power boards and the relevant connectors check and measure the continuity of the protective circuit earth connection between the masses of the container and the earthing splitter of the electrical system on which the machine was installed check the condition of the transformers and auto transformers check the condition of the safety components generally check the int

STILA ENERGY Mach2000 SYSTEMS MODEL STANDARD USER S MANUAL Rel 01 2008 hy Stila Energy S p A Stila Energy STILA ENERGY S p A Via Ippodromo 61 20151 MILAN ITALY Telephone 39 02 40918310 Fax 39 02 40917052 Mach2000 User Manual page 2 41 Stila Energy 1 GENERAL DESCRIPTION OF Mach2000 The systems in the Mach2000 family are electronically controlled electromechanical appliances designed to optimise the management and powering of large fluorescent and gas discharge lighting installations allowing for the reduction of energy consumption and prolonging the durability of the lamps The operating principle is based on exploiting the characteristic brilliancy current curve of gas discharge lamps through the variation of the voltage feed after an initial warm up period The appliances are composed of the following fundamental parts a single phase autotransformer for each phase with various taps at different voltage values that in combination with one another generate 19 different voltage values single phase transformer for each phase powered at variable voltage on the primary circuit of the autotransformer an intelligent power card for each phase dedicated to the switching of the autotransformer s taps through a relay of adequate power an electronic command section controlled by microprocessor a main switch with a manual power by pass function a magnetot

26. h2000 Mach2000 gradually takes the output voltage to the warm up value and performs the start of the lamp warming cycle as per set program The time required to reach the warm up voltage depends on the settings of Mach2000 and on the time when the INT Maxx interface is activated The INT MAxx modules can be used also for controlling the status of the switches of any electrical panel and therefore for general signalling of line faults Three possible versions can be composed with each other INT MAOS5 gt for controlling 5 lines therefore with 5 inputs INT MA10 gt for controlling 10 lines therefore with 10 inputs INT MA15 gt for controlling 15 lines therefore with 15 inputs The can be used in parallel and in any possible combination e g if there are 20 switches you can associate a 5 input and a 15 input module or two modules with 10 inputs or even four of 5 inputs Whatever the model the dimensions are 70X156X90 mm 9 DIN units The power supply of INT MAxx is 230V Neutral and the switch inputs are always 230V in the standard version but a version with 24Vac potential inputs can be obtained on request Installation procedure connect the cable commanding the coil of the contactors of the illumination lines whose status you wish to check on the control electrical panel and the cables powering the interface from the 230 Volt auxiliary circuits Relays can be used in the absence of the power up contactors In an
27. hem is too low to maintain the electrical arc The shut down flickering of the lamps that are close to burning out is evident at least initially only when there are decreases in the network voltage feed that occur at certain times of day Usually in the middle of the day The phenomenon progressively deteriorates until the lamps remain permanently shut off Based on this same principle a sudden reduction in voltage and current created aritficially by Mach2000 will shut off the lamps that would have burned out in the following weeks A specific example can be made with HPS lamps high pressure sodium these lamps can tolerate when they are new a minimum voltage of less than 170 V The test can be set so that after an adequate warm up period for the lamps at nominal voltage it calls for a sudden decrease in voltage from 230 V to 195 V The lamps that go out at 195 V because of the test have been operating for at least 15 000 hours and it might be best to replace them The lamps that have reached this uneconomic phase of their lifespan can burn out within the following few months or weeks and their brilliancy levels are 35 40 lower than a new lamp while consuming the same amount of energy 100 and continuing to turn them on and off causes damage to the reactors and ignitors Replacing these lamps allows for the restoration of higher average lighting values decreasing the number of maintenance calls and the realization of greater ene

34. nal consent to activate the load At this point using the key access the next screen which is CONFIGURATION in order to set the basic operating parameters for the automatic programs Mach2000 User Manual page 12 41 Stila Energy 6 CONFIGURATION The configuration parameters are the operating foundations for all the automatic programs for Mach2000 and they always condition the management of the appliance There are three fundamental parameters 1 RUPT Ramp UP Time voltage increase speed to desired value 2 FACT FAlling Commutation Time voltage decrease speed to desired value 3 STAB STABilisation precision in voltage stabilization The choice of values to program is closely connected to the type of lamps that are to be managed and to the reactivity to be given to the Mach2000 gt minimum RUPT and FACT times determine high reactivity and speed with which the desired voltage values are reached but higher stress for the lamps the best stabilization values 0 5 allow for optimal management and protection for particularly delicate lamps metallic iodide but force Mach2000 to perform an elevated number of operations in the case of very unstable power feeds that could reduce the durability of some components WARNING It is advised at least at the beginning to use the default parameters set in the factory then check the need to change one or more of these parameters 6 1 PROGRAMMING THE CONF
